Marcus & Millichap is pleased to present this 24-hour CVS Pharmacy in the historic Hampton, Virginia. Built in 2014, this relatively new construction CVS is equipped with a drive-thru, and has 23 years remaining on an absolute net lease with zero landlord responsibilities. This asset has 10, five-year renewal options, where rent increases to fair market value in the third option. CVS is required to pay for all expenses associated with the property including the maintenance, repair, and replacement of the roof, structure, and parking lot. The lease is guaranteed by CVS Health Corporation with annual revenues exceeding $177 billion and a net worth of more than $36-billion. CVS Health ranked number seven on the 2016 Fortune 500 list. This opportunity also presents investors with an attractive assumable loan: 3.80 percent interest rate, 10-year balloon and 30-year amortization
This highly visible CVS is located at the intersection of North Armistead Avenue and West Mercury Boulevard, a ten-lane thoroughfare with traffic counts that exceed 73,000 vehicles per day. This asset is located less than two miles south of Sentara CarePlex Hospital, a 224-bed facility with surgical and diagnostic capabilities, and specialized services in cardiac and vascular care.
CVS is also ideally located a half-mile from the Peninsula Town Center, a $300 million mixed use live-work-play development. Peninsula is a premium outdoor center featuring more than 70 specialty retailers, restaurants, luxury apartments, professional office spaces and a movie theatre with bowling and billiards. Hampton boasts strong demographics as well, there are more than 187,000 residents with an average household income greater than $61,000 in the five-mile radius.

Hampton is a Virginia city located on the southeast end of the Virginia Peninsula. It is bounded on the north and east by the Chesapeake Bay and on the south by the Hampton Roads Harbor. The city is situated about 16 miles north of Norfolk, to which it is connected by Interstate I-64. Hampton is served by two airports: the primary area airport is Norfolk International Airport in Norfolk; and the region’s secondary airport is Newport News/Williamsburg International Airport, located in Newport News.
A Hampton landmark is the Virginia Air & Space Center, the official visitor center for NASA’s Langley Research Center. Here visitors can see the Apollo 12 Command Capsule that journeyed to the moon, experience a state-of-the-art virtual-reality video on the pioneers of flying, and much more. The Hampton History Museum, located in historic downtown, tells the storied history of Hampton. Costumed interpreters are on-hand to help visitors understand the significance and context of the exhibits. Also located downtown is The Charles H. Taylor Arts Center, a 1925 structure which served as Hampton’s public library for over 60 years. After careful renovation and restoration, the building now presents changing exhibitions of the best of local, regional, and national artists. And no Hampton attraction is more significant than the Casemate Museum at Fort Monroe, which is the largest stone fort ever built in the United States. The Museum chronicles the Fort’s role during the Civil War and contains the cell in which Confederate President Jefferson Davis was imprisoned.
Coliseum Central Master Plan
In the heart of Hampton lies the Coliseum Central area. In 2015 the city of Hampton partnered with Urban Design Associates to put together The Coliseum Central Master Plan. This plan encompasses the Coliseum Central Business Improvement District (CCBID) as well as the surrounding neighborhoods and natural environments. Nearly three square miles in size, CCBID is one of the largest business improvement districts in the nation. It is centrally located within the region at the crossroads of Interstate 64 and Interstate 664.
Some of the major elements included in the master plan involve the development of high-quality hotel rooms to support the Hampton Roads Convention Center, sports tourism, and other tourism initiatives. The Coliseum Development program also plans on constructing new restaurants in walking distance to hotels and assembly venues. The master plan also wants to identify and explore new opportunities to expand the District’s breadth of sports tourism venues. In order to respond to changing market conditions Hampton will be implementing new street and block infrastructure that is flexible. Hampton also wants to develop new high-quality residential development in walkable mixed-use districts.
The success of this commercial district is critical to the City of Hampton. It has historically served as one of the major regional shopping districts for the Virginia Peninsula and generates a significant proportion of taxes for the city. Two public-private partnerships and the Coliseum Central Master Plan have served as catalysts for the redevelopment of this district and the preservation of its tax base.
